What permits and credentials should I verify before hiring for a major patio and grading project?
Any contractor altering drainage on a 0.35-acre lot must be registered with the Pennsylvania Attorney General as a Home Improvement Contractor. The contractor should also pull any necessary permits from Lower Macungie Township Planning & Zoning, especially for work affecting lot grading or stormwater flow. This ensures the work meets code, protects your investment, and avoids liability for downstream runoff issues.
Is Pennsylvania Bluestone a better choice than a wooden deck?
For longevity and minimal maintenance, Pennsylvania Bluestone is superior. It offers a permanent, non-combustible surface with a lifespan measured in decades, unlike wood which requires regular sealing and replacement. In terms of Firewise principles for our low-risk urban interface, bluestone provides excellent defensible space directly adjacent to the home, adding a layer of passive fire protection.
How can I keep my Kentucky Bluegrass blend green during summer without wasting water?
Under Lehigh County's Stage 0 voluntary conservation, smart Wi-Fi ET-based irrigation is essential. This system uses local weather data to apply water only when evapotranspiration rates demand it, matching the precise needs of your turfgrass blend. This method can reduce water use by 20-30% compared to timer-based systems, maintaining turf health while adhering to municipal water stewardship goals.

I'm tired of weekly mowing. What's a lower-maintenance, eco-friendly alternative?
Transitioning perimeter areas to a native plant community using species like Butterfly Milkweed, Little Bluestem, and New England Aster drastically reduces mowing, watering, and chemical needs. This xeriscaping approach builds biodiversity and resilience ahead of regulatory trends, such as potential future restrictions on gas-powered blowers governed by the local noise ordinance. It creates a landscape that manages itself.
My yard stays soggy for days after rain. What's a lasting solution?
Seasonal saturation is common in our silt loam over clay subsoil. The primary fix involves regrading to create positive surface flow away from foundations and installing subsurface French drains. For new patios or walkways, using permeable-set Pennsylvania Bluestone allows water infiltration, which can help projects meet Lower Macungie Township's stormwater runoff management standards for a 0.35-acre lot.
What invasive plants should I watch for, and how do I remove them safely?
Common invaders here include Japanese Knotweed and Garlic Mustard, which outcompete natives. Manual removal is effective for new infestations. For chemical control, use a targeted, non-phosphorus herbicide applied by a licensed professional to ensure compliance with Pennsylvania's residential turf phosphorus restrictions. Always treat before these plants set seed to prevent further spread.
My lawn seems thin and compacted. Is this just normal for our area?
Properties in Wescosville Proper, typically developed around 1983, have soils about 43 years old. The Dystrudepts silt loam common here was often stripped and compacted during construction, limiting root depth and organic matter. This mature but degraded soil profile requires core aeration to alleviate compaction and annual top-dressing with compost to rebuild structure and microbial life, moving it beyond basic builder's grade.
